# version:      1.0 for linux

# method:       全备份mysql数据

# author:       fengzhanhai

# history:      create program V1.0 20121101 by fengzhanhai

# tasks: * 1 * * * /home/db-backup/mysql/mysqlbk.sh >> /dev/null 2>&1

#conf---------

UserName='sdmtv'

myPwd='sdtv@13.cm'

DbName=mms_sdmtv

BakDir=/data/tongji/

LogFile=/data/tongji/backdb.log

DATE=`date +%Y%m%d`

DumpFile=data$DATE.sql

FtpServer=10.0.211.12

FtpTargetPath=/root/mon

#main-------------

echo $(date +"%y-%m-%d %H:%M:%S") backup begin >> $LogFile

cd $BakDir

#备份当天文件

/usr/bin/mysqldump -u$UserName -p$myPwd $DbName -t > $BakDir$DumpFile

echo $(date +"%y-%m-%d %H:%M:%S") Dump Done >> $LogFile

echo $(date +"%y-%m-%d %H:%M:%S") $GZDumpFile compress done >> $LogFile

#上传到ftp服务器

ftp -v -n  $FtpServer << END

user dbback1 s.allook.cn

bin

#cd $FtpTargetPath

put $DumpFile

bye

END

echo $(date +"%y-%m-%d %H:%M:%S") ftp $GZDumpFile compress done >> $LogFile

rm -f $GZDumpFile

#删除当前目录下7天前的文件备份文件

find $BakDir -name "data*" -mtime +7 -exec  rm {} \;

echo $(date +"%y-%m-%d %H:%M:%S") delete old file done >> $LogFile

#验证结果

ls -al $DumpFile >> $LogFile

mysql视图表修复_mysql中含有视图数据库在恢复数据时视图变成数据表的解决方法...相关推荐

  1. Easyui中使用jquery或js动态添加元素时出现的样式失效的解决方法

    Easyui中使用jquery或js动态添加元素时出现的样式失效的解决方法 在添加完之后,可以使用 $.parser.parse();这个方法进行处理: (1) 对整个页面重新渲染: $.parser ...

  2. SqlYong连接MySql数据时,出现错误代码2003的解决方法

    问题描述: 在我刚刚安装完SqlYong后,准备用SqlYong连接MySql数据时,出现错误代码2003. 解决方法: MySql没有开始,只需要启动MySql即可. (我的电脑右键-管理-服务  ...

  3. jsp 插入mysql乱码_JSP MySQL插入数据时出现中文乱码问题的解决方法

    当向 MySQL 数据库插入一条带有中文的数据形如 insert into employee values(null,'张三','female','1995-10-08','2015-11-12',' ...

  4. mysql 字符串 空格函数_mysql中的去除空格函数

    (1)mysql replace 函数 语法:replace(object,search,replace) 意思:把object中出现search的全部替换为replace 案例:update `ne ...

  5. mysql获取当月最后一天_mysql中获取本月第一天、本月最后一天、上月第一天、上月最后一天

    mysql获取当月最后一天_mysql中获取本月第一天.本月最后一天.上月第一天.上月最后一天等等 转自: https://blog.csdn.net/min996358312/article/det ...

  6. mysql 5.7 1054_MySQL5.7更改密码时出现ERROR 1054 (42S22)的解决方法

    MySQL5.7更改密码时出现ERROR 1054 (42S22)的解决方法 发布时间:2020-10-14 16:01:38 来源:脚本之家 阅读:81 作者:剑侠365 新安装的MySQL5.7, ...

  7. 在xp中不能查看或更改文件夹的“只读”属性或“系统”属性解决方法

    在xp中不能查看或更改文件夹的"只读"属性或"系统"属性解决方法 症状  您可能会遇到下列任一症状: • 不能使用文件夹的"属性"对话框查看 ...

  8. confluence中org.apache.tomcat.util.net.NioEndpoint$Acceptor.run Socket accept failed的解决方法

    confluence中org.apache.tomcat.util.net.NioEndpoint$Acceptor.run Socket accept failed的解决方法 参考文章: (1)co ...

  9. PL/SQL中查询Oracle大数(17位以上)时显示科学计数法的解决方法

    PL/SQL中查询Oracle大数(17位以上)时显示科学计数法的解决方法 参考文章: (1)PL/SQL中查询Oracle大数(17位以上)时显示科学计数法的解决方法 (2)https://www. ...

最新文章

  1. python判断是否回文_对python判断是否回文数的实例详解
  2. POJ 1006 Biorhythms 中国的法律来解决剩余的正式
  3. 少走弯路,给Java 1~5 年程序员的建议
  4. HQL多对多的查询语句
  5. js获取字符串最后一个字符代码
  6. 前端学习(5):深入了解网站开发
  7. CentOS8安装jdk1.8
  8. python中控脚本_python连接中控考勤机分析数据
  9. 高盛报告:未来5-10年区块链将被广泛应用【附下载】
  10. 电脑屏幕亮度调节器-护目镜
  11. uniapp中app、h5、小程序引入高德地图定位,并封装起来调用。
  12. 胡说八道设计模式—观察者模式
  13. 自动驾驶的分级,感知与规划基本意义
  14. java游戏 天剑传承,《天剑传承》之无双迷宫攻略
  15. wampserver下载及用法
  16. 转换为本地时间 java_UTC时间转换为本地时间(JAVA)
  17. 冻肉进口报关注意事项及进口企业都应该具备哪些资质?
  18. PR软件中的音频硬件扬声器显示不工作的故障
  19. ChinaRen社区暴强回复
  20. 零基础自学-英文原版Python笔记003: 应用Python的场合使用Python的机构

热门文章

  1. 串口开发,数据类型转换——字符串转 byte[],byte[]转二进制,二进制转十进制转byte[],byte[]转十进制,byte[]拼接,校验
  2. Android 使用mqtt实例,包括接收服务器推送以及上传数据到服务器
  3. java的input不能更改,无法将方法响应标头Content-Type更改为application / xml
  4. php利用ajax文件上传,如何在PHP中利用AjaxForm实现一个文件上传功能
  5. 1064. 朋友数(20)
  6. linux就业技术指导,学linux前景怎么样
  7. 服务器mysql如何添加数据库文件,如何在使用MySQL作为嵌入式服务器时创建数据库文件...
  8. MySQL和SQL Server数据库基本语句总结(二)
  9. Thread类学习(一)
  10. 20154319 《网络对抗技术》后门原理与实践